Working in UK - Family members of Entrepreneur (Tier 1) Visa holder

UK Entrepreneur (Tier 1) Visa
Your family members (‘dependants’) can travel with you when you travel to the UK on Entrepreneur Visa (Tier 1) visa.

Your family members must have a visa if they’re from outside the European Economic Area (EEA) or Switzerland.

A ‘dependant’ is any of the following:
  • your partner
  • your child under 18
  • your child over 18 if they’re currently in the UK as a dependant

NOTE: adult family members must provide a criminal record certificate from any country they have lived in for 12 months or more in the last 10 years.

They’ll also have to pay the healthcare surcharge as part of their application. 

They must complete their visa application by 5 July if they’ve already paid the immigration health surcharge or they might have to pay it twice. They’ll get a refund for their first payment.

Savings
You must show that your dependants can be supported while they’re in the UK.

Each dependant must have a certain amount of money available to them - this is in addition to the £945 you must have to support yourself.

The amount depends on your circumstances. You must have £1,890 for each dependant if you’re applying from outside the UK or have been in the UK for less than 12 months. If you’ve been in the UK for more than 12 months, you must have £630 for each dependant.

You must have proof you have the money, and that it’s been in your bank account or your dependant’s bank account for at least 90 days before you or they apply.

Example: You must have £4,725 if you want to bring your partner and one child with you to the UK (£945 to support yourself plus £1,890 for your partner and £1,890 for your child).

Dependants applying outside the UK
Your family members must apply online.

They’ll need to have their fingerprints and photograph taken at a visa application centre (to get a biometric residence permit) as part of their application.

They’ll have to collect their biometric residence permit within 10 days of when they said they’d arrive in the UK (even if they actually arrive at a later date).

Dependants applying in the UK on their own
Your dependants can apply to extend or switch their visas to stay with you if they’re already in the UK. Dependants can:
  • apply online - dependant partner application
  • apply online - dependant child application
  • download the paper form
  • apply in person for the premium service
You must use the paper form if you’re applying as a family group at the same time or using the premium service.

NOTE: Family members cannot apply in the UK as your dependant if they hold a visitor visa.

Children born while you’re in the UK
If you have children while you’re in the UK, you can apply for permission for them to stay.

You must do this if you want to travel in and out of the UK with them.

When you apply, send a full UK birth certificate for each child showing the names of both parents.

You can:
  • apply online - dependant child application
  • download the paper form
  • apply in person for the premium service
You must use the paper form if you’re applying as a family group at the same time or using the premium service.
